
Gamers waiting to get their hands on the first PlayStation 3 bundles might want to start saving now. The prices are out on Play.com in the U.K., and they’re expensive.
From MTV:
Play.com is selling the PlayStation 3 with the 60GB hard drive and three games for 549 pounds, roughly $1,016. The three games included are Warhawk, Formula One 06, and SingStar--perfect for gamers who like air combat, driving, and karaoke games.

Another interesting thing to note is the fact Play.com is expecting shortages.
This from the site:
Due to an expected European shortage of the PS3, we are unable to guarantee delivery of your PS3 before Christmas. All pre-orders will be fulfilled on a first come, first served basis and game titles in this package may be changed, subject to availability.
